The Egglburger See is the largest lake in the district of Ebersberg in Upper Bavaria. The Egglburger See is 33 hectares in size and is located on the west side of the district town of Ebersberg directly (360 meters away) on the southern edge of the Ebersberg Forest, specifically the Eglhartinger Forest. The lake is 1100 meters long from northwest to southeast, up to 410 meters wide, and lies at an altitude of 553.0 meters. According to monastic records, an abbot Altmann had the Ebrach dammed around 1040, thereby creating Lake Egglburg. On the shores of the lake are the hamlets of Hinteregglburg and Egglsee, as well as the homestead of Ziegelhof. To the south of the lake there is a moss (moor and meadows), where the Moosbach, the largest tributary, begins. The little river Ebrach represents the outflow of Lake Egglburg in the southeast. Lake Egglburg is at the beginning of a chain of small ponds and lakes along the Ebrach. Since the lake is in a nature reserve, bathing is only permitted after August 1st. Due to the shallow depth of only about two meters and the large amount of mud and reeds, it is not very suitable as a bathing lake - on the other hand, it is an important breeding and resting place for e.g. T. rare birds. In recent years it has lost its importance as a nationally important breeding ground for black-headed gulls, mainly because of increasing silting up; the black-headed gull colony there was at times one of the largest in Bavaria. Which lakes are best for swimming near Aßling?

For swimming, Klostersee near Ebersberg is an excellent choice, consistently rated with 'excellent' water quality by the EU. It functions as a free outdoor swimming area with amenities like showers and changing rooms. Steinsee is also known for its clean and generally warm water, offering both a public beach and a paid swimming area. Kastenseeon is a warm bog lake, particularly suitable for families with small children.

Are there family-friendly lakes around Aßling?

Yes, several lakes near Aßling are ideal for families. Klostersee near Ebersberg offers a free outdoor swimming area with facilities like showers and changing rooms. Kastenseeon, a warm bog lake, is also very suitable for families with small children. Steinsee and Egglburger Lake are also categorized as family-friendly, offering pleasant environments for all ages.

What natural features can I observe around the lakes?

The lakes near Aßling offer diverse natural beauty. Egglburger Lake is known for its serene natural environment, perfect for unwinding. Kitzlsee, a small, forest-lined lake, is protected by a wide reed and lava belt, offering magnificent views and excellent opportunities for birdwatching. The Oak Avenue at Egglburger Lake, with its over one hundred-year-old oak trees, is a listed natural monument providing a unique natural spectacle.

Are there cafes or restaurants directly at the lakes?

Yes, some lakes offer refreshment options. At Klostersee near Ebersberg, you'll find a 'Seecafé' where you can relax with a drink and a snack. Egglburger Lake also features a tavern with a beer garden. While Steinsee has a swimming pool on one side that requires admission, the public beach area is more rustic, so it's advisable to check local amenities for food and drink options there.
